Residents of Capistrano Valley Mobile Estates hope a certain kind of home improvement doesn’t get too close to their neighborhood.

“We know we are going to get a neighbor, but we do not want Home Depot,” said resident Jack Heath, who is the spokesman for the mobile home park on Avenida Aeropuerto.

The home improvement giant wants to open a 105,000-square-foot store with a 25,000-square-foot garden center near Stonehill Drive and Camino Capistrano.

Heath believes the store would create excessive noise from delivery trucks and lumber cutting, cut off natural breezes and open-space access, create too much lighting at night from its 800-space parking lot and pollute the neighborhood with diesel fumes.

Councilman David M. Swerdlin said the council will not consider Home Depot’s proposal unless changes are made to address those concerns.

Home Depot representatives were unavailable for comment Friday.
